Output 595c15c93c13e23b191973f5c54a3e4e721f1b1fc9bac579de03e7b7ab96415a:2

value
12439970
script pubkey
OP_0 OP_PUSHBYTES_20 12092f2bccb187f09ea7368dea9f51ab467c0e59
address
tb1qzgyj727vkxrlp848x6x748634dr8crje9sk00k
transaction
595c15c93c13e23b191973f5c54a3e4e721f1b1fc9bac579de03e7b7ab96415a
confirmations
36129
spent
true